I tried plot a 3d animated but it doesn't work.

figure(3)
z = Y(:,4);
y = Y(:,5);
x = Y(:,6);
curve = animatedline('LineWidth',2);
hold on;
for i=1:length(z)
addpoints(curve,x(i),y(i),z(i));
head = plot3(x(i),y(i),z(i),'filled','MarkerFaceColor','r');
drawnow
pause(0.001);
delete(head);
end
Error using plot3
Invalid color, marker, or line style.

I think you want to use scatter3 and not plot3. See below for a demonstration, i commented some line to run it in the browser (which doesn't support animations).
But essentially, the only change is plot3 into scatter3.

figure(3)
z = Y(:,4);
y = Y(:,5);
x = Y(:,6);
curve = animatedline('LineWidth',2);
hold on;
for i=1:50%length(z)
addpoints(curve,x(i),y(i),z(i));
head = scatter3(x(i),y(i),z(i),'r','filled');
drawnow
% pause(0.001);
% delete(head);
end
view(3); xlabel('X'); ylabel('Y'); zlabel('Z'); grid on
